Introduction:

This program is designed to prepare participants for the certification exam only.

Project management is a structured discipline that governs the planning, execution, monitoring, and closing of initiatives aligned with organizational objectives. The PMP credential, offers a globally recognized standard for managing projects across industries. It enables professionals to lead projects with strategic intent, define clear deliverables, manage risks, and ensure alignment with organizational priorities. It reflects advanced capabilities in managing constraints, leading teams, and ensuring strategic alignment across project phases. This training program is designed to support professionals in mastering PMI-aligned project management frameworks.

Program Outline:

Unit 1:

Project Management Frameworks and Structures:

  • PMI’s definition of a project and project management.

  • Project phases and process groups, from Initiating to Closing.

  • Relationship between project, program, and portfolio management.

  • Role of the project manager across functional and matrix environments.

  • Overview of the PMBOK® Guide structure.

Unit 2:

Planning, Scope, and Schedule Management:

  • Project charter development and project plan elements.

  • Tools for defining scope and managing change.

  • Work Breakdown Structures (WBS) and task sequencing.

  • Schedule development methods and critical path modeling.

  • Time estimation techniques and milestones tracking.

Unit 3:

Risk, Quality, and Procurement Management:

  • Identification and classification methods of risks.

  • Quantitative and qualitative risk analysis frameworks.

  • Quality assurance models and control tools.

  • Contract types, procurement documents, and vendor management methods.

  • Evaluation criteria of external dependencies and contract compliance.

Unit 4:

Stakeholder, Communication, and Resource Management:

  • Stakeholder identification and influence analysis process.

  • Communication models and project information reporting steps.

  • Resource planning and team development structures.

  • Leadership approaches within project environments.

  • Key activities for managing team performance and addressing conflicts.

Unit 5:

PMP Certification Preparation:

  • Structure and format of the PMP exam.

  • Reviewing key topics and areas of emphasis in the exam syllabus.

  • Sample exam questions and their potential answers.

  • Resources and study materials for exam preparation.
